7 Attractions in Lucerne
Chapel Bridge
Landmark 1300s wooden bridge with grand stone water tower & a roof decorated with 17th-century art.
Spreuerbrücke
15th-century, covered pedestrian bridge featuring a series of paintings with a death motif.
Schloss Heidegg
Centuries-old castle & park with a local history museum, period rooms & a renowned rose garden.
Männliturm
Stalwart guard towers & clock tower accessible by steep stairs & offering scenic city views.
